Amp-hours
A power tool battery's capacity is determined in amp hours (AH), which refers to the length of time it can sustain a constant present flow, generally an electric drill or other cordless power tool. For example, a battery with an AH score of 4 may last twice as long as one with an AH score of 2.
While the total wattage of a tool's motor is essential for determining how powerful it is, the amount of time a battery can offer constant power without being recharged is what matters for run time. The majority of lithium-ion (Li-ion) batteries used in cordless power tools have a 300 to 500 cycle life, meaning they can be charged and discharged a minimum of that number of times before requiring to be changed. In comparison, NiCd batteries just have a 100 to 200 cycle life, and nickel-metal hydride (NiMH) ones are even less long lasting.
Besides the battery's cycle life, other elements also affect the length of time a battery can deliver constant run time, such as how the battery is set up and its storage conditions. Many battery sets will feature a charger that will increase the AH capability of the battery when it's in use, which also improves its longevity and avoids over-charging.
The most common kinds of batteries for cordless power tools are Li-ion and nickel-metal hydride (NiMH), though brushed and brushless tool motors can also be powered by lead acid batteries. Li-ion batteries are most popular because of their high energy capabilities, lightweight and fast charging abilities. When shopping for a battery, try to find a brand that provides several alternatives within its platform to guarantee the tool you desire will be suitable with it.
Batteries
As battery-powered tools gain popularity, manufacturers continue to innovate and develop much better batteries that are lighter, have longer life and provide more power. When looking for a cordless tool combo set, pay attention to how many rechargeable lithium ion batteries it includes. The majority of sets consist of a minimum of two and some have bigger capacity batteries. Some even offer a fast charger, which minimizes downtime by accelerating the time it takes to charge.
Another essential consideration for purchasers is whether the set's tools have brushed or brushless motors. Typically speaking, brushes produce more friction and are less long lasting than their brushless counterparts. As a result, they tend to need to be changed more regularly than their brushless equivalents.
Preferably, you need to prevent combo kits that include tools with brushed motors, and rather decide for models with brushless motors. These types of tools require less upkeep and frequently featured a longer guarantee than their brushed equivalents.
